Vyřešeno: volání funkce s prameters inm tlačítko tkinter

Hlavním problémem je, že funkce nebude volána se správným počtem argumentů.

In Python, you can call a function with parameters in a Tkinter button by using the command attribute of the button. For example, if you have a function named my_func that takes two parameters, you can call it like this:

button = tkinter.Button(root, text="Click me", command=lambda: my_func(param1, param2))

V tomto kódu se vytváří tlačítko, které po kliknutí zavolá funkci my_func s parametry param1 a param2.

Tkinter

Tkinter je sada nástrojů GUI pro Python. Poskytuje jednoduché a snadno použitelné rozhraní pro vytváření grafických uživatelských rozhraní. Tkinter lze použít k vytváření aplikací, jako jsou interaktivní nabídky, dialogová okna a okna.

Předejte argumenty Buttonovi pomocí Tkinter

V Pythonu můžete použít klíčové slovo pass k volání funkce bez zadávání jakýchkoli argumentů. To je užitečné, když chcete volat funkci s konkrétními argumenty, ale nevíte, jaké to jsou.

Chcete-li volat funkci se specifickými argumenty, můžete použít klíčové slovo argv.

Související příspěvky:

Zanechat komentář